Prof. Yordan Zaimov (1921 – 1987), D. Sc. was born on April 23, 1921 
in the city of Sofia. He graduated in Slavic Philology at Sofia University “St. Climent Ohridski” in 1944. His teachers were one of the most 
brilliant scientists of their time. 
His exceptional linguistic training (he 
speaks eight languages) was the basis on which the scholar achieved his 
remarkable success in difficult linguistic disciplines such as etymology, 
onomastics and history of language. 
His scientific activity was entirely 
related to the Institute of Bulgarian Language at the Bulgarian Academy 
of Sciences. The article presents important stages of his life devoted 
to science, as well as the remarkable peaks of his multifaceted work. 
He will remain in the memory of future generations not only with his 
works, but also as an example of unconditional patriotism...
